The remote services: the network of the libraries of the INRIA

As a national institution currently active on 19 different sites, the INRIA was very soon taken with the idea of operating as a network. As an institution of research into information technology, heavily involved in the development of the Internet and the web, it has favoured an early appropriation of communication technologies by all its component sections together. The INRIA's information officers have been well aware in this context of the opportunity to develop a truly professional network, based on the use of collaborative tools and the sharing of resources and abilities, the objective being to optimise the range of documentary resources of the five documentation centres and to make the collections accessible to all the research teams, regardless of their location.
